What is Chicken Marsala?

Chicken Marsala is a Sicilian-inspired dish featuring:

  • Pan-seared chicken cutlets
  • Sautéed mushrooms (cremini or button)
  • A luscious sauce made with Marsala wine, broth, and cream

It’s named after Marsala wine, a fortified wine from Sicily that adds a unique depth of flavor.


Classic Chicken Marsala Recipe

Ingredients (Serves 4)

  • 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ts (pounded thin)
  • 8 oz cremini mushrooms, sliced
  • 1/2 cup Marsala wine (dry or sweet)
  • 1/2 cup chicken broth
  • 1/4 cup heavy cream (or half-and-half)
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1/4 cup flour (for dredging)
  • 2 tbsp olive oil
  • 2 tbsp butter
  • Salt & pepper to taste
  •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)

Step-by-Step Instructions

1. Prep the Chicken

  • Pound chicken breasts to 1/4-inch thickness for even cooking.
  • Season with salt and pepper, then dredge in flour (shake off excess).

2. Sear the Chicken

  •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at.
  • Cook chicken 3–4 mins per side until golden. Remove and set aside.

3. Sauté Mushrooms & Garlic

  • In the same pan, melt 1 tbsp butter.
  • Add mushrooms and cook 5 mins until browned.
  • Stir in garlic for 30 sec until fragrant.

4. Deglaze with Marsala Wine

  • Pour in Marsala wine, scraping up browned bits.
  • Simmer 2–3 mins until slightly reduced.

5. Finish the Sauce

  • Add chicken broth and heavy cream.
  • Simmer 5 mins until thickened.
  • Stir in 1 tbsp butter for extra richness.

6. Combine & Serve

  • Return chicken to the pan, coating it in the sauce.
  • Garnish with fresh parsley and serve hot.

Tips for the Best Chicken Marsala

✔ Use thin-cut chicken (or pound it yourself) for even cooking.
✔ Don’t skip deglazing—the browned bits add flavor.
✔ Choose good Marsala wine (dry for a less sweet sauce, sweet for richness).
✔ Substitute cream with Greek yogurt for a lighter version.


What to Serve with Chicken Marsala

  • Pasta (fettuccine, linguine)
  • Mashed potatoes (creamy pairing)
  • Roasted vegetables (asparagus, green beans)
  • Crusty bread (to soak up the sauce)

People Also Ask (FAQs)

1. Can I use a substitute for Marsala wine?

Yes! Use dry sherry, white wine + sugar, or balsamic vinegar + broth in a pinch.

2. Is Chicken Marsala gluten-free?

Not traditionally (flour dredge), but use GF flour or cornstarch to make it GF.

3. Can I make Chicken Marsala ahead?

Yes, but store sauce separately and reheat gently to avoid overcooking chicken.

4. What’s the difference between dry and sweet Marsala wine?

  • Dry Marsala = less sweet, more savory (best for cooking).
  • Sweet Marsala = richer, dessert-like (great for creamy sauces).

Variations to Try

  • Mushroom Marsala (vegetarian version)
  • Pork or Veal Marsala (alternative proteins)
  • Lightened-up Marsala (skip cream, use broth + cornstarch)
